Why Arcadia Homes Need a Local Garage Door Specialist

Arcadia's housing stock runs the gamut. You've got everything from 1950s ranch homes with single car garages to newer two-story builds with three-car setups. Older homes often have original hardware that's decades past its useful life, while newer construction sometimes comes with builder-grade openers that fail within the first few years. The variety means we see different problems depending on which part of town we're in.

The San Gabriel Valley weather is generally mild, but summer heat still takes its toll. Garage doors face south or west get baked, which dries out springs and shortens their lifespan. Most springs last 7 to 9 years, not the 10 some manufacturers claim. When they break, it's usually sudden and loud.

Arcadia homeowners also deal with something many don't think about: dust and debris from the nearby foothills. That fine grit works its way into rollers and tracks, causing grinding noises and uneven movement. Regular maintenance catches this before it becomes a bigger headache.

What We Do for Arcadia Homeowners

Our bread and butter is fixing what breaks. Spring replacement is our most common call because springs wear out from constant cycling. We carry the right springs for standard and custom doors, and we replace them in pairs so you're not dealing with a second failure a month later.

Opener installations are straightforward when you work with quality brands. We install L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ie units. Smart openers with WiFi connectivity are popular in Arcadia, especially for homeowners who want app control and delivery notifications. We'll walk you through the options without pushing you toward the most expensive model.

Cable and roller repair keeps doors running smoothly. Frayed cables are dangerous and need immediate attention. Worn rollers cause that awful scraping sound every time the door moves. Both are quick fixes when caught early.

Full door replacement happens when repair costs don't make sense anymore. We handle everything from permits to hauling away your old door. Insulated doors are worth considering if your garage shares a wall with living space or if you use the garage as a workshop.

What's the most common garage door problem you see in Arcadia?

Broken springs, hands down. They account for about 60% of our Arcadia calls. Springs have a cycle life (usually 10,000 to 15,000 cycles), and once they reach that limit, they snap. If your door feels heavy when you lift it manually or won't open at all, it's almost always springs.
